”Chorus Line” Stars Make Command Performance — at a Center City Gym

Members of the touring company of the stage musical “A Chorus Line” taught a dance class on Thursday afternoon at the 12th Street Gym in center city Philadelphia.

Musical theatre enthusiasts packed into the class, where performer Ian Liberto made a special-guest-teacher appearance:

“When we are in rehearsals in New York, our choreographer has a very specific, stylized warm-up. So we’re going to teach a little bit of that warm-up, and then we’re going to teach a little bit of choreography from the show — specifically, the finale.”

Liberto plays Bobby Mills III in the show, currently playing at the Forrest Theatre:

“If you are familiar with the show, he’s very eccentric and he breaks into people’s houses and rearranges their furniture.”
